Understanding Customer Relationship Management (CRM) Software for Small Businesses
For small businesses looking to streamline their operations and improve customer relationships,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software has emerged as a powerful tool. CRM software for small business allows companies to manage and track interactions with customers, prospects, and vendors in one centralized location. This not only enhances efficiency but also provides valuable insights into customer behavior and trends, enabling businesses to make data-driven decisions.
By utilizing CRM software, small businesses can automate various tasks such as lead generation, sales tracking, and marketing campaigns. This automation liberates time for employees to focus on more strategic initiatives while ensuring that every customer interaction is captured and organized. Furthermore, effective CRM software offers robust reporting capabilities, allowing business owners to analyze key performance indicators (KPIs) and identify areas for growth or improvement.

Popular Free CRM Software Options to Consider
When it comes to managing customer relationships for small businesses on a budget, free CRM software options offer a powerful alternative to expensive solutions. These tools provide essential features like contact management, sales pipeline tracking, and marketing automation, tailored specifically for growing enterprises. Popular choices include HubSpot CRM, Zoho CRM, and Pipedrive, each with unique strengths that cater to various business needs.
HubSpot stands out for its all-in-one marketing, sales, and service capabilities, making it ideal for businesses looking for a comprehensive platform. Zoho, on the other hand, excels in customizability and integrates seamlessly with other productivity tools. Pipedrive is praised for its intuitive visual pipeline representation, perfect for teams that prefer a simple, user-friendly interface. These free CRM options empower small businesses to streamline their operations, enhance customer interactions, and drive growth without breaking the bank.
Features and Functionalities to Look Out For in a Free CRM
When exploring free CRM software options for your small business, it’s crucial to assess the features and functionalities that align with your unique needs. Look for tools that offer robust contact and lead management capabilities, allowing you to track interactions, store customer data securely, and segment your audience effectively. Automation is another key aspect; seek options that enable automated tasks such as email marketing campaigns, lead scoring, and task assignments to streamline your sales process.
Additionally, consider the level of reporting and analytics provided. Comprehensive reporting features empower you to gain valuable insights into sales performance, customer behavior, and team productivity. Ensure the software integrates seamlessly with other tools you use, like email marketing platforms or accounting software, for a cohesive workflow. Think about scalability too; while free options have limitations, seek solutions that offer growth potential should your business expand.
Implementing and Optimizing Your Chosen Free CRM Software
Implementing and optimizing your chosen free CRM software is a crucial step in leveraging its full potential for your small business. Start by thoroughly exploring the platform’s features to understand how it aligns with your operations. Many free CRM options offer robust capabilities, including contact management, sales pipeline tracking, and automated communication tools, so ensure these meet your immediate needs. Customize your settings to tailor the software to your unique workflows, creating efficient processes that streamline your sales and customer engagement activities.
Once set up, actively engage with the software to optimize its performance. Train your team members to use it effectively, ensuring everyone understands their roles within the CRM ecosystem. Regularly review analytics and reports provided by the platform to gain insights into customer behavior, identify trends, and make data-driven decisions. Continuously updating and refining your processes based on these insights will help maximize the benefits of your free CRM software, ultimately enhancing your small business’s Customer Relationship Management (CRM) capabilities.
